Queen Victoria and her husband Albert had 9 children: Victoria, Albert Edward, Alice, Alfred, Elena, Louise, Arthur, Leopold and Beatrice. Subsequently, the longest reigning queen became the grandmother of 42 grandchildren.
And the son of Queen Victoria, King Edward VII and his wife Alexandra of Denmark had six children (one child died in infancy). They were born from 1864 to 1870.
His son King George V and Mary of Teck had six children. By the way, George was incredibly similar to his cousin, the Russian Emperor Nicholas II, who, in turn, had four daughters and one son.
The son of George V, King George VI and his wife Elizabeth Bowes Lyon had two children, but rumors come from various memoir sources that the king had health problems, therefore only two.
But their daughter Queen Elizabeth II and her husband Philip became the parents of four offspring: Charles, Prince of Wales, Anne, Princess of Great Britain, Andrew, Duke of York and Edward, Earl of Wessex.
Their son — heir Charles and his wife Diana Spencer have two sons, but who knows, if things had turned out differently, there could have been more.
